Home Screen Menu Composition After the printer starts up, the HOME screen appears on the touch screen. From the HOME screen, you can check the printer status and select the maintenance, paper operations, settings, and other menus. Basic Touch Screen Operations Icons on Touch Screen A: Printer Information Display Area Displays the printer status, messages, and other information. Tap this item when a message appears to view the message on the list screen and to jump to the screen with detailed information and operations. Notification Messages B: Ink Display Area Displays the ink status. Tap this item to view the remaining amount of ink and how to replace the ink tanks. C: Paper Setting Display Area Displays the media information for each feeding location. Tap this item to configure the size and type of the paper loaded. D: Other Menu Items Displays the items used to perform maintenance and configure the various settings. Setting Items on Operation Panel Note • By default, menu settings apply to all print jobs. However, for settings that are also available in the printer driver, the values specified in the printer driver take priority. Basic Touch Screen Operations You can select various functions and settings by gently touching and swiping the touch screen with your fingertip. 182
